Brad Heidt (Kerrobert, SK) finished 5-5 in the 0-team qualifying round. . In their opening game, Heidt defeated
Glen Hudy (Yellowknife, NT) 8-2, then won 6-5 against Randy Neufeld (La Salle, MB). Heidt went on to lose 6-2 against Ed Lukowich (Calgary, AB). Heidt lost 7-5 to Walter Wallingham (Whitehorse, YK) where Heidt responded with a 5-2 win over Robbie Gordon (Sudbury, NONT). Heidt went on to lose 7-3 against Bryan Cochrane (Russell, ON). Heidt responded with a 7-6 win over Alan O'Leary (Dartmouth, NS). Heidt went on to lose 5-3 against Bob Ursel (Kelowna, BC). Heidt responded with a 6-4 win over Jeff Thomas (St. John's, NL). Heidt went on to lose 4-3 against Rod MacDonald (Charlottetown, PEI) in their final qualifying round match.
